Basic facts about this digital color

#FCD7CE falls into the Red Color Family — Full Saturation, Luminous brightness. Its exact recipe is rgb(252, 215, 206) — 98.8% red, 84.3% green, 80.8% blue — and for print it converts to CMYK 0 / 15 / 18 / 1. New to color codes? See our guide to RGB color codes.

The color #FCD7CE reads as a pure, full-strength warm red and is nearly as bright as white. Designers typically reach for tones like this for minimalist layouts, soft backgrounds and pastel palettes. In The Official Register of Color Names it is a hair away from Cosmos (#FCD5CF). Its next-closest registered neighbors are Pippin (#FCDBD2) and Unbleached Silk (#FFDDCA).

Technically, the mix leans on its red channel (rgb(252, 215, 206)), which gives #FCD7CE its character. Accessibility-wise, black text works best on #FCD7CE: 15.8:1 contrast (passing WCAG AAA) versus 1.3:1 for white. #FCD7CE has no official name yet. #FCD7CE color harmonies

Color harmonies are pleasing color schemes created according to their position on a color wheel.

Complementary

Complementary color schemes are made by picking two opposite colors con the color wheel. They appear vibrant near to each other.

Complementary color schemes

Split complementary

Split complementary schemes are like complementary but they uses two adiacent colors of the complement. They are more flexible than complementary ones.

Split complementary color scheme

Analogous

Analogous color schemes are made by picking three colors that are next to each other on the color wheel. They are perceived as calm and serene.

Analogous color scheme

Triadic

Triadic color schemes are created by picking three colors equally spaced on the color wheel. They appear quite contrasted and multicolored.

Triadic color scheme

Tetradic

Tetradic color schemes are made form two couples of complementary colors in a rectangular shape on the color wheel.

Tetradic color scheme

Square

Square color schemes are like tetradic arranged in a square instead of rectangle. Colors appear even more contrasting.
